Address

ScfpmZSdh6K29ev4TfD9o7uFxv3hETpXYd

0 SATOX

Confirmed
Total Received681427.23088849 SATOX
Total Sent681427.23088849 SATOX
Final Balance0 SATOX
No. Transactions2

Transactions

ScfpmZSdh6K29ev4TfD9o7uFxv3hETpXYd681427.23088849 SATOX
 
 
ScfpmZSdh6K29ev4TfD9o7uFxv3hETpXYd681427.23088849 SATOX